Answer:

C. p(x) =  16x - 25

Step-by-step explanation:

1. First define the equation that describes the profit Luisa earns, that is the revenue for mowing minus the Luisa´s cost for gas and the mower rental. So the equation is:

p(x) = (r – c)(x) (Eq.1)

2. Write the equations for the revenue for mowing and the cost for gas and the mower rental:

- Equation for the revenue for mowing:

r(x) = 20x (Eq.2)

- Equation for the cost for gas and the mower rental:

c(x) = 4x + 25 (Eq.3)

3. Replace the equations Eq. 2 and Eq. 3 in Eq. 1:

p(x) = (r – c)(x)

p(x) = 20x - (4x + 25)

p(x) = 20x - 4x - 25

p(x) = 16x - 25

Samantha has a rectangular shaped fish tank in her room. The tank has a height of 2.6 ft, a width of 2.1 ft, and a length of 3.9
andrezito [222]

Answer: the BEST approximation of the amount of water her fish tank can hold is 21ft^3

Step-by-step explanation:

The shape of Samantha's fish tank is rectangular. The volume of the rectangular fish tank would be expressed as LWH

Where

L represents length of the tank

W represents the width of the tank.

H represents the height of the tank.

The tank has a height of 2.6 ft, a width of 2.1 ft, and a length of 3.9 ft.

This means that the volume of the fish tank would be

Volume = 2.6 × 2.1 × 3.9

= 21.294 ft^3
